草庐IT

selected_parents

全部标签

mysql - 在 SELECT 语句中组合两个字段

在我的表中,我有一个字段“firstname”和一个字段“lastname”。我想选择firstname+space+lastname为特定值的所有记录。我试过了:$sql="SELECT*FROMsam_usersWHERE(user_firstname+''+user_lastnameLIKE?)";但这行不通。通过Google,我发现了一些关于使用||的信息,但我真的不明白我应该如何使用该运算符。请注意,我不想使用或运算符(||在许多语言中是什么),而是要连接2个字段(它们之间有一个空格)并在其上使用LIKE。谢谢! 最佳答案

mysql - 在 SELECT 语句中组合两个字段

在我的表中,我有一个字段“firstname”和一个字段“lastname”。我想选择firstname+space+lastname为特定值的所有记录。我试过了:$sql="SELECT*FROMsam_usersWHERE(user_firstname+''+user_lastnameLIKE?)";但这行不通。通过Google,我发现了一些关于使用||的信息,但我真的不明白我应该如何使用该运算符。请注意,我不想使用或运算符(||在许多语言中是什么),而是要连接2个字段(它们之间有一个空格)并在其上使用LIKE。谢谢! 最佳答案

Mysql工作台 "Too many objects are selected for auto placement. Select fewer elements to create the EER diagram."

我正在尝试在ubuntu中使用Mysqlworkbench生成ER图。Thedatabasecontains755Tables错误信息Toomanyobjectsareselectedforautoplacement.SelectfewerelementstocreatetheEERdiagram.是否有可能避免此错误并继续一次为所有755个表创建逆向工程 最佳答案 Workbench发出“资源警告”错误,然后为您取消选择“将导入的对象放在图表上”选项。在没有该选项的情况下再次执行它(单击“执行”)以执行逆向工程向导。然后,创建一个

Mysql工作台 "Too many objects are selected for auto placement. Select fewer elements to create the EER diagram."

我正在尝试在ubuntu中使用Mysqlworkbench生成ER图。Thedatabasecontains755Tables错误信息Toomanyobjectsareselectedforautoplacement.SelectfewerelementstocreatetheEERdiagram.是否有可能避免此错误并继续一次为所有755个表创建逆向工程 最佳答案 Workbench发出“资源警告”错误,然后为您取消选择“将导入的对象放在图表上”选项。在没有该选项的情况下再次执行它(单击“执行”)以执行逆向工程向导。然后,创建一个

mysql - 用于测试连接性的通用 SELECT 查询

我们的应用程序适用于MySQL、MSSQLServer和Oracle数据库。我们的C3P0配置使用preferredTestQuery选项来测试连接性。这是我们的Spring配置${database.initialPoolSize:10}${database.minPoolSize:1}${database.maxPoolSize:25}${database.acquireRetryAttempts:10}${database.acquireIncrement:5}${database.idleConnectionTestPeriod:60}${database.maxIdleTime

mysql - 用于测试连接性的通用 SELECT 查询

我们的应用程序适用于MySQL、MSSQLServer和Oracle数据库。我们的C3P0配置使用preferredTestQuery选项来测试连接性。这是我们的Spring配置${database.initialPoolSize:10}${database.minPoolSize:1}${database.maxPoolSize:25}${database.acquireRetryAttempts:10}${database.acquireIncrement:5}${database.idleConnectionTestPeriod:60}${database.maxIdleTime

mysql - 为什么 MySQL 'insert into ... select ...' 比单独选择慢这么多?

我正在尝试将查询结果存储在临时表中以供进一步处理。createtemporarytabletmpTest(aFLOAT,bFLOAT,cFLOAT)engine=memory;insertintotmpTest(selecta,b,cfromsomeTablewhere...);但由于某种原因,插入需要一分钟,而单独的子选择只需要几秒钟。为什么将数据写入临时表而不是将其打印到我的SQL管理工具的输出中需要更长的时间???更新我的设置:MySQL7.3.2集群与8个DebianLinuxndb数据节点1个SQL节点(WindowsServer2012)我正在运行选择的表是ndb表。我试图

mysql - 为什么 MySQL 'insert into ... select ...' 比单独选择慢这么多?

我正在尝试将查询结果存储在临时表中以供进一步处理。createtemporarytabletmpTest(aFLOAT,bFLOAT,cFLOAT)engine=memory;insertintotmpTest(selecta,b,cfromsomeTablewhere...);但由于某种原因,插入需要一分钟,而单独的子选择只需要几秒钟。为什么将数据写入临时表而不是将其打印到我的SQL管理工具的输出中需要更长的时间???更新我的设置:MySQL7.3.2集群与8个DebianLinuxndb数据节点1个SQL节点(WindowsServer2012)我正在运行选择的表是ndb表。我试图

mysql - SQL SELECT WHERE NOT IN 来自同一表查询

我在使用以下SQL查询和MySQL时遇到问题SELECTid,cpid,label,cpdatetimeFROMmytableASaWHEREidNOTIN(SELECTidFROMmytableASbWHEREa.label=b.labelANDa.cpdatetime>b.cpdatetime)ANDlabelLIKE'CB%'ANDcpidLIKE:cpidGROUPBYlabelORDERBYcpdatetimeASC表格是这样的1|170.1|CB55|2013-01-0100:00:012|135.5|CB55|2013-01-0100:00:023|135.6|CB59|

mysql - SQL SELECT WHERE NOT IN 来自同一表查询

我在使用以下SQL查询和MySQL时遇到问题SELECTid,cpid,label,cpdatetimeFROMmytableASaWHEREidNOTIN(SELECTidFROMmytableASbWHEREa.label=b.labelANDa.cpdatetime>b.cpdatetime)ANDlabelLIKE'CB%'ANDcpidLIKE:cpidGROUPBYlabelORDERBYcpdatetimeASC表格是这样的1|170.1|CB55|2013-01-0100:00:012|135.5|CB55|2013-01-0100:00:023|135.6|CB59|